Topic: Another SuperPower Organteq example, now with 160 stops!

Toccata and fugue in F Major by Buxtehude and two organs of extraordinary powers, layered Organteqs. Orgtq 1 and Orgtq 2.

You should be allowed to play it to truly experience, but listening is also enough. I love it.

Organteq 1   44 stops,    Organteq 2  116 stops,   160 stops used in the piece Toccata and fugue by Buxtehude
The preset A Clockwork organ , Orgtq 2, has an important part in the soundpicture.
Organteq is a wonderful toolbox.

Depending on your equipment and headphones, you might need to turn up the volume a bit....
